Per-team dynamic flags for Docker/file-based challenges
- Dockerized challenges may now use per-team dynamic flags. When a container is started for a team (or individual in solo mode) the platform generates a unique, time-scoped flag and injects it into the running container at the path configured by the challenge admin (
docker_flag_path). This prevents simple flag sharing and enables each team to have a unique indicator inside their container. - The generated dynamic flags are deterministic per (challenge, team/user, date) so that restarting a session within the same day keeps the same flag value.

Flag-sharing detection and admin visibility
- If a user submits a dynamic flag that belongs to a different team or user, the submission handler now detects that and records a
FlagAbuseAttemptin the database. Administrators can review these attempts in the Admin → Flag Sharing page and see helpful context (submitter, claimed owner, challenge, IP, and human-readable owner names). - Frequent or repeated abuse attempts are logged for review — this helps detect intentional sharing or misuse of dynamic flags.

Database schema helper (self-healing migrations)
- Startup logic includes an idempotent schema helper that will create missing columns/tables used by the Docker and flag-abuse changes. If your deployment is running an older schema and you see OperationalError exceptions related to missing columns (for example
challenges.docker_flag_path), make sure the running app process executes thescripts/ensure_docker_schema.pyhelper (it is normally called at app startup). If you run into problems, execute the helper inside your app container so it has the same import paths and DB access.

Container lifecycle and permission hardening
- The container injection logic now ensures the target directory exists, writes the flag file with permissive file mode, and runs a best-effort
chmodinside the container. This avoids permission errors when in-container services try to modify the flag file. - Background reconciliation and container cleanup were improved to help with stuck containers or expired sessions. Admins can also force-clean containers from the admin UI if necessary.

git clone https://github.com/Unknnownnn/Blackbox.git
cd Blackbox
# Create virtual environment
python -m venv venv
source venv/bin/activate # On Windows: venv\Scripts\activate
# Install dependencies
pip install -r requirements.txt
# Set up database
# Install MariaDB/MySQL and Redis
# Configure environment
cp .env.example .env
# Edit .env with your database and Redis credentials
# Initialize database
python init_db.py
# Start the application
python app.py
# Or with Gunicorn (production)
gunicorn -c gunicorn.conf.py app:appCreate a .env file with the following:
# Flask
SECRET_KEY=your-secret-key-here
FLASK_ENV=production
DEBUG=false
# Database
DATABASE_URL=mysql+pymysql://blackbox_user:secure_password@blackbox-db:3306/ctf_platform
# Redis
REDIS_URL=redis://blackbox-redis:6379/0
# Application
CTF_NAME=My_CTF
CTF_DESCRIPTION=Sample_Text
REGISTRATION_ENABLED=true
# File Uploads
MAX_UPLOAD_SIZE=52428800
# Server
HOST=0.0.0.0
PORT=8000
WORKERS=4- Register: Create an account (if registration is enabled)
